Adaptation Statement
This GitBook is not a copy of the GOV.UK Service Manual. It is a tailored operating guide that adapts the GOV.UK agile delivery approach for our professional services model.
The tailoring adds:
Statement of Work alignment
commercial governance
milestone and acceptance controls
reusable IP and accelerator controls
supplier and subcontractor alignment
security and data assurance
delivery evidence standards
practical checklists and templates

Important Boundary
This playbook explains our delivery process. It does not replace the contract, Framework Agreement, Statement of Work, data processing terms, security schedule or any other legally binding document. Where there is conflict, the signed contractual documents take precedence.
